## Formula sandbox tuning

User-supplied formulas in Gridmoor execute inside a restricted interpreter with hard ceilings on time, memory, and call depth. Reviewers should confirm any change to these ceilings is justified in the PR description, since raising them widens the abuse surface. Defaults were chosen from production traces. The current limits are as follows.

limits module of tafog-fawip:
WEIGHTS = {
    "julix": 57,
    "lamys": 992,
    "kasvan": 209,
    "quenok": 750,
    "alddor": 259,
    "oliath": 1009,
    "wenix": 815,
}

**Q: How are audio waveform previews generated in Sylphdeck?**

When a clip is uploaded, the Peakrender worker samples the file and stores a compact peaks array, which the player draws client-side. Previews usually appear within 30 seconds; long files can take a few minutes. If a waveform never renders, the worker likely rejected the codec. The supported-format list and regeneration steps are on the internal page below.

wiki page, hahif-hahif: https://argocd.kelvisys.corp/browse/board/settings/pages/1442e0b1065d83f1

Runbook: account recovery for Glimmertpl render nodes. If the perf dashboard shows p95 render latency over 400ms, first check the fragment cache hit rate before touching the admin console. Restarting the renderer requires the ops account; it auto-locks after three failed attempts. Reviewers approving cache-layer changes need that account too. To restore access once locked, enter the recovery passphrase below.

unlock words, hahip-baduf: holwyn-istath-julvan

## PedalShift Rebalancer — Plugin Hooks

Plugin authors extending the PedalShift rebalancing tool should register their dock-capacity handlers before the nightly optimizer run at 02:00 local time. Handlers receive a read-only snapshot of station fill levels across the Varnholm metro zone; do not mutate these records directly. All writes must go through the queued adjustment API, which validates against the live inventory store. For local testing, point your handler harness at the staging inventory database using the connection string below.

replica DSN, kajep-yahag: mssql://praok_svc:iF@db-8d68.plorvaio.local:5432/eliion